Indications of Roofing Leaks and Exactly How to Take care of Them



A leaking roofing can turn your home into a headache if not resolved without delay. You could observe water spots on your ceiling or walls, which frequently indicate a leak. If you see peeling off paint or mold and mildew growth, it's a sign that moisture is trapped. Furthermore, listen for trickling audios during rain; that's a clear warning.


To repair these issues, begin by locating the resource of the leakage. Inspect your attic room for signs of dampness or water entrance. You can seal small spaces with roofing concrete or caulk once you recognize the problem location. For more considerable damage, you may require to replace tiles or perhaps fix flashing. If you're not sure, always ensure safety and security first-- utilize a sturdy ladder and think about working with a professional. Resolving leaks immediately can aid you avoid expensive fixings down the line and keep your home dry and safe.

Indications of Water Damages



While examining your roof covering for missing or damaged roof shingles, seek signs of water damage that can show underlying issues. Inspect for dark touches or discolorations on the shingles, as these typically signal dampness infiltration. If you notice any type of crinkled or bent shingles, they may likewise be endangered, permitting water to seep through. Furthermore, check the sides of your roof covering and around chimneys for any type of signs of rot or mold, which can hint at extended wetness direct exposure. Do not neglect to examine your attic for water spots or damp insulation, as these can reveal leaks. Dealing with these indications early can avoid a lot more substantial damages and expensive repair services down the line, guaranteeing your home continues to be protected.

Understanding Roof Ventilation Issues



Proper roof ventilation is important for preserving the stability of your home, as it assists control temperature and moisture levels in the attic. Without adequate air flow, you could face serious issues like mold development, timber rot, and boosted power expenses. Inspect your roofing system for signs of poor ventilation, such as too much warmth in the attic room during hot months or condensation basing on rafters.


You should additionally seek unequal snow melting in wintertime, indicating trapped warmth. If you see any one of these signs, it's time to evaluate your air flow system. Make certain you have a balanced intake and exhaust system, permitting fresh air in and stagnant air out.


You may require to include ridge vents, soffit vents, or gable vents to enhance airflow. Regular upkeep and tracking can prevent costly fixings down the line, so do not neglect this important aspect of your roof.
